Madison Area Chamber of Commerce Technology Showcase

I love it when businesses get together to hold a technology showcase of any kind and was particularly happy to see that Madison Chamber of Commerce is holding a technology showcase. According to the Madison Courier, there will be 12 information booths available for browsing. Starting at 11:30 a.m., each exhibitor will give a 5- to 7-minute presentation about the technology he or she is exhibiting.
The Courier lists the exhibiting companies as:
Cable Advisory Board of Madison and Jefferson County
Cingular Wireless
Ebit Information Systems
Ivy Tech Community College of Indiana
Jim Gordon Inc.
K2 Technologies
Knight Security Services Inc.
The Madison Courier
Microdome Computers
PaulGlowiak.com
SEI Communications
WORX/WXGO
